Kings County, New Brunswick Probate Record Books
Volume D, page 23
LDS Family History Library Microfilm 861205

Will

In the Name of God Amen I William Secord late of the Parish of Greenwich now residen in Springfield being come to a Grate lengh of days and Known that it is apointed for all men once to die do make and Ordain this my last Will and Testament, that is to say, principally and first of all I give and recommend my Soul into the hands of Almighty God the give it and my Body I commend to the Earth to be Buried in decent Christian Burail at the discretion of my Executuors Nothing dubtin but at the General Resurrection I Shall reseve the same again by the Mighty power of God, and as touching such Worldly Estate werewith it hath pleased God to bles me in this life I give devise and dispose of the same in the following manner and form
First I give and Bequeath to the Heirs of my Son William deceased the Sum of Five Pounds.
Also to my Daughter Rachel the Sum of Five Pounds.
To my Daughter Anne's Heirs the Sum of Six Pounds.
To my Daughter Sarah the Sum of Four Pounds.
To my Daughter Elizabeth the Sum of Four Pounds
To my Daughter Olive the Sum of Ten Pounds
To my Daughter Susan the Sum of Three Pounds
To my Daughter Mary the Sum of Six Pounds
The remainder of my effects is to be divided evenly betwixt my four Sons. And I constitute make and Ordain my Son James Sole Executor of this my Last Will and Testament. In Witness whereof I have hereunto Set my hand and Seal this twenty first day of October in the Year of Our Lord One thousand Eight hundred and forty three.
